Job Description

Operations is at the heart of Amazon's business, delivering tens of thousands of products to hundreds of countries worldwide daily. The Reliability & Maintenance Engineering (RME) team works behind the scenes to ensure smooth operations. As a Senior Automation Engineer, you'll play a crucial role in maximizing equipment reliability and operational performance in fulfillment centers.

You'll be responsible for providing proactive controls automation and technical support, troubleshooting complex control systems, and driving continuous improvement initiatives. The role involves working with state-of-the-art technology, including conveyors, sortation systems, scanners, cameras, and SCADA systems.

Key responsibilities include maintaining automation systems, collaborating with various teams (Operations, Engineering, Safety), troubleshooting material handling control systems, and monitoring performance metrics. You'll mentor junior engineers and lead cross-functional teams to optimize MHE systems and implement innovative projects.

The position requires expertise in PLC/PC controllers, industrial networks (Ethernet, ControlNet, DeviceNet, Profibus), motor control systems, and electrical distribution systems. You'll be involved in failure analysis, system assessments, and continuous improvement processes.

Responsibilities For Senior Automation Engineer

  • Serve as site expert for maintaining automation systems critical to operations
  • Collaborate with Operations, Engineering teams, and Safety to support MHE systems optimization
  • Maintain and troubleshoot material handling control systems including PLC/PC controllers
  • Monitor MHE metrics and address system performance issues
  • Provide second-level escalation support to site technicians
  • Facilitate Failure Analysis and Incident Review processes
  • Perform and analyze building System Assessments
  • Communicate technical issues and project timelines to stakeholders

Requirements For Senior Automation Engineer

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, electrical engineering, automation engineering, or equivalent
  • 4+ years of PLC programming or automation engineering experience
  • 2+ years of process/production environment PLC-controlled automation experience
  • 2+ years of robotics work cells and control systems experience
  • 2+ years of Siemens, Allen-Bradley or Codesys Ladder Logic programming experience
  • 2+ years of electrical theory and automated equipment experience
  • Experience with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S)
  • Flexible schedule including weekends, nights, and holidays
